A splash of bourbon or gin would turns this sweet drink into a seasonal cocktail, but they’re great even alcohol-free.

Course Drink
Ingredients
- 1 cup sugar
- 3 cups tap water
- 2 whole pears peeled, cored and diced
- 20-25 fresh sage leaves
Instructions
- Bring the sugar and water to a boil over medium heat, then turn down to low and simmer, stirring occasionally, until the sugar has dissolved completely.
- Add the pears and sage, then simmer until the entire mixture has reduced by half, about 1 hour.
- Let cool and pour over sparkling or soda water.
- Add booze if you want.
